Cryptic species have been found in a wide range of marine organisms ; with majority of them are benthic invertebrates. in contrast, marine holoplanktons are thought to have lower diversity and slow speciation due to their strong dispersal potential. this paper reviewed studies on cryptic species and speciation in marine holoplankton. based on findings in 38 studied taxa, it was concluded that : 1 ) cryptic species are pervasive in marine holoplankton, suggesting holoplankton speciation was more active than previously thought ; 2 ) current morphospecies diversity is untenable to reflect true species diversity in marine holoplankton ; 3 ) geographic isolation may facilitate cryptic speciation of marine holoplankton. however, contribution of allopatric speciation is still questionable ; 4 ) ecological speciation may be the prevailing speciation mode in marine holoplankton. cryptic speciation in marine holoplankton is paradoxical, because rapid speciation under strong gene flow is countertuitive. solution of this paradox will help us gain deep insights of marine speciation and biodivesity
